As a senior member of the Committees on the Judiciary, Homeland Security, and the Budget, I rise in support of the House Amendment to the Senate Amendment to H.R. 2471, the ``Consolidated Appropriations Act, 2022'' which provides funding for federal government operations for the remainder of this fiscal year-- through September 30, 2022--and prevents a wasteful and irresponsible shutdown of the federal government. The Consolidated Appropriations Act includes all 12 appropriations bills that fund the federal government through the end of Fiscal Year 2022, as well as urgently needed supplemental appropriations. The legislation includes $13.6 billion in emergency funding for the courageous people of Ukraine, to support their security and humanitarian efforts as they struggle to survive and battle against the invading Russian army. I am particularly pleased that the Consolidated Appropriations Act specifically includes $24,435,000 for Community Funding Projects in Houston that will directly help my constituents and enable all Houston- area residents to benefit from quality-of-life improvements.
